About Elizabeth

Elizabeth Steingass, Artist

Elizabeth Steingass is a formally trained and award-winning artist working in acrylic, gouache, oil, watercolor, and pencil. Her work consists of still life paintings, figure and portrait drawings, landscape paintings, and pet portraits.

Elizabeth has been awarded Honorable Mention in the Toledo Artists Club People and Portrait Show for her piece, “Man at Saint Ignace”. She has painted murals in private homes and corporate settings. Elizabeth’s commissioned works include small portraits, pet portraits, two custom maps, as well as festival photo props, and a 16-foot barn quilt. Elizabeth received a Bachelor of Arts degree in Artistic and Religious Studies from Spring Arbor University in Spring Arbor, MI. Her degree focused heavily on studio arts, specifically painting and drawing. While at Spring Arbor University, several of Elizabeth’s works were included in the end of semester student shows.

Elizabeth has been living and working in the Toledo area where she completes commissioned work, original works, and is an Associate Member of the Toledo Artists’ Club.
